Rezumat

This paper reports the numerical results on the synchronization features of a chaotic quantum dot semiconductor laser. The dynamic behavior is studied in terms of the Bloch equations model. Optimum conditions for chaotic operation are found. The synchronization of two unidirectional-coupled (master–slave) systems and the effect of parameter mismatch on the synchronization quality are studied.
